/* CSS Document */
* {
	margin:0px;
	padding:0px;
	list-style:none;
}
.clear {
	clear:both;
}

.L{ float:left;}

.R{ float:right;}

#pt_L.Ll{ float:right;}
#pt_R.Rr{ float:left;}

a {
	text-decoration:none;

}
a:hover {
	text-decoration:none;

}
img {
	border:none;
}

.p{ padding:0; margin:0;}

/*--------------------------------------------------- top begin*/

body {
	font-family:"宋体";
	font-size:12px;
	background:#eeeeef;
}
.wrapp {
	width:980px;
	overflow:hidden;
	margin:0px auto;
}
#top {
	width:100%;
	height:83px;
}
#logo {
     width:1000px;
	 margin:0 auto;
}

#logo span{ float:left; font:12px "微软雅黑"; margin-top:20px; color:#949494; font-weight:bold;}


#top p {
	float:right;
	width:40%;
	text-align:right;
	padding-right:15px;
	height:60px;
	margin-top:5px;
	
	
}
.iphone{ font:14px "微软雅黑";font-style:italic; color:#606060;}
.sz{ font:24px "微软雅黑";font-style:italic; color:#424242;}



/*banner图片轮换begin*/
#xxx{margin:0 auto; width:610px;}

.mainbox{
    overflow:hidden;
    position:relative;

}
.flashbox{
   overflow:hidden;
    position:relative;
}
.imagebox{
    position:relative;
	text-align:center;
}

.bitdiv{display:inline-block;width:11px;height:11px;margin:0 18px 10px 0px;cursor:pointer;}
.defimg{background-image:url(../images/02.png)}
.curimg{background-image:url(../images/01.png)}
/*banner图片轮换END*/



/*-------------------------------------------------------------banner begin*/


/*-------------------------------------------------------------main begin*/

#main,#main1,#main2{ margin:0 auto;width:980px;overflow:hidden;}

#main{background:#fff;/* border-bottom:9px solid #eeeef0;*/}

#main1{background:#fff;}

#main2{background:#fff; padding-bottom:20px;}

#con{ width:946px; margin:0 auto;}
/*.w_1{ margin:10px 30px;_ margin:10px 24px;}

.tv_2 li{ float:left; margin-right:15px;}

.yun_1{ background:url(../images/form_bg.jpg) repeat-x; height:451px; border-bottom:10px solid #f0690f;}

.w_3{ margin-top:35px;}

.ww_1{ width:1000px; margin:0 auto;}
.cu_1{ font-size:14px; color:#30302e; font-weight:bold;}
.w_3{ margin-right:33px; padding-bottom:30px;}

input{ background:#aeaeae; width:335px; height:32px; border:none; padding-left:3px; margin:10px 0; border-top:1px solid #929292;}

.frm{ width:352px;}
textarea{ background:#aeaeae; width:349px; height:89px; border:none; padding:3px; margin:10px 0; border-top:1px solid #929292;}*/

/************************************首页内容部分样式**********/

/*教师简介*/
#laoshi{ overflow:hidden;}

.ls_1{ overflow:hidden; float:left; width:300px; margin:0px 5px  0px 10px; height:205px; }

.jies{ width:175px; margin-left:18px; margin-top:40px;}

.mz_1{ font-size:14px; font-weight:bold; color:#4f4f4f; border-bottom:1px solid #8f8f8f; margin-bottom:8px; padding-bottom:8px;}

.mz_2{ color:#7b7b7b;}

.line_0{ border:1px solid #f00;}

.wi_1{ width:488px; color:#595959; line-height:1.5em;}

.mz_3{ font-size:22px; font-weight:bold; border-bottom:1px solid #8f8f8f; margin-bottom:8px;margin-top:8px; padding-bottom:8px;}

.jy_1{ text-align:center;}

.siw_15{ font:15px "微软雅黑"; color:#717171;}

.sif_31{ font:31px "方正兰亭特黑简体"; color:#4d4d4d;}

.siw2_14{ font:14px "微软雅黑";}

.siw2_14 span{ color:#e73828;}



/**************************课程部分 开始*/

.h1_1{ font:18px "微软雅黑";
      /* background:url(../images/bt_b.jpg) no-repeat 0 5px;*/
	   padding-left:10px; margin:29px 0px; color:#1b1b1b; }


.kc1 li{ float:left; margin:0px 16px 16px 0;}

.kc01,.kc02,.kc03,.kc04,.kc05,.kc06,.kc07,.kc08,.kc09,.kc010{width:173px;padding-top:70px; padding-bottom:16px;text-align:center; font:14px "微软雅黑";}


.kc01{ background:url(../images/kc1/1.jpg) no-repeat;}
.kc02{ background:url(../images/kc1/2.jpg) no-repeat;}
.kc03{ background:url(../images/kc1/3.jpg) no-repeat;}
.kc04{ background:url(../images/kc1/4.jpg) no-repeat;}
.kc05{ background:url(../images/kc1/5.jpg) no-repeat;}
.kc06{ background:url(../images/kc1/6.jpg) no-repeat;}
.kc07{ background:url(../images/kc1/7.jpg) no-repeat;}
.kc08{ background:url(../images/kc1/8.jpg) no-repeat;}
.kc09{ background:url(../images/kc1/9.jpg) no-repeat;}
.kc010{ background:url(../images/kc1/10.jpg) no-repeat;}

.kc01 a{ color:#878787;}
.kc02 a{ color:#768e98;}
.kc03 a{ color:#aa8479;}
.kc04 a{ color:#879b80;}
.kc05 a{ color:#797979;}
.kc06 a{ color:#b78898;}
.kc07 a{ color:#7897a9;}
.kc08 a{ color:#7f7f7f;}
.kc09 a{ color:#748694;}
.kc010 a{ color:#97a975;}

.dui{}

.dui li{ width:300px; float:left; line-height:1.5em; margin-bottom:25px;}

.huiz{ color:#949494;}

.heiz{ color:#5c5c5c;}

.h2_1{ font:16px "宋体"; margin:29px 0px; color:#5c5c5c; font-weight:bold;}


/**********************课程部分 结束*/

/*******************上半部分--左*/

#pt_L{ width:610px; margin-top:16px;} 

#pt_R{ width:319px;} 

.lbnr{ background:url(../images/l_banner_di.jpg) no-repeat; height:71px; color:#fff; line-height:1.5em; padding:10px 5px 0 10px;}


/*#yeyu{ overflow:hidden; height:397px;}
*//*结业前*/
/*.jyq,.jyh,.zb{ font:14px "宋体";color:#072141; height:315px;}

.jyq{ width:257px; background:url(../images/l_huit.jpg) no-repeat;}

.mgl{ font-weight:bold; margin-left:115px;}

.jq_1 span{ margin:0 40px 0 20px; overflow:hidden}

.jyq p{ margin-bottom:40px;}


.zb{ background:url(../images/l_huit1.jpg) no-repeat;}

*/
/*结业后*/
/*.jyh{ width:303px; background:url(../images/l_huit2.jpg) no-repeat;}

.mg2{ font-weight:bold; margin-left:35px;}

.jq_2 span{ margin-left:32px;}

.jyh p{ margin-bottom:40px;}




.zb{ background:url(../images/l_huit1.jpg) no-repeat; width:49px;}
*/
/*表单部分*/

input,select{ height:34px; line-height:34px; font:14px "微软雅黑"; padding-left:15px; color:#000000; margin-top:6px;}

input{ width:300px; border:2px solid #cacaca;}

.mg_2{ margin-top:2px;}

/*select{ width:319px; background:url(../images/select.jpg) no-repeat; border:none; overflow:hidden;}
*/
option{}

.select { width:335px;background:url(../images/select.jpg) no-repeat; margin:0; padding:0; border:none; margin-top:7px;}     
#sleHid { display:block; width:318px; overflow:hidden; }     
#sleBG  { display:block;} 


#sut{ background:#424242; color:#fff; width:318px; text-align:center; margin-top:8px; overflow:hidden; border:none; font-weight:900;}


.mt{ margin-top:35px;}

.mt_1{ padding-bottom:30px;}

/*学员案例*/

.xyal,.xyal_1{ width:365px;font-size:14px;height:198px; color:#214d8c;}

.xyal li,.xyal_1 li{ height:28px; line-height:28px; margin-bottom:6px;}

.xyal{ border-right:1px solid #cfced3; margin-left:7px; }

.xyal_1 li{ height:28px; line-height:28px; margin-bottom:6px;}


.qh{ background:#f4f4f4;}

.sh{ background:#e4e4e4;}

.xm,.danw,.zhiw{ float:left;}

.xm{ width:60px; display:block;}

.danw{ width:135px; display:block;}

.zhiw{ width:160x; display:block;}



/*就业学员*/

.ten{ color:#5e5e5e; line-height:2em; padding-top:15px;}

.jyxy li{ float:left; margin:4.5px;}

.xm{ margin-left:18px;}

.danw{ width:135px; overflow:hidden}





/*===================================================================================================================footer begin*/
#footer {
	/*background:url(images/bg_copy.gif) repeat-x;*/
	background-color:#313131;
	height:100px;
}
#container {
	padding-top:24px;
	width:992px;
	height:80px;
	margin:0px auto;
	border-bottom:1px solid #484848;
}
#container h1 {
	padding-left:43px;
}
#container p {
	padding:10px 20px 0px 35px;
	color:#fff;
	font-family:"宋体";
	font-size:12px;
	line-height:22px;
}
#footer a {
	color:#fff;
}
#footer a:hover {
	color:#FFF;
}
#db_nav {
	text-align:center;
	color:#fff;
	font-family:"宋体";
	font-size:12px;
	line-height:20px;
	padding-top:20px;
}


/*课程样式*/


#course h1 a:hover{
        color:#ff0000;
}




#course{
	width:946px;
	height:370px;


	float:left;

}
#course h1{
	font-size:14px;
	padding:15px 0 5px 0;
}
#course h1 a,#course h1 a:hover{
        color:#ff0000;
}
#course dl{
	width:270px;
	height:60px;
	padding:30px 15px 0 20px;
	float:left;
}
#course dl dt{
	float:left;
}
#course dl dd{
	width:200px;
	padding:3px 0 2px 8px;
	float:left;
	font-weight:bold;
}
#course dl dd.date{
	font-weight:normal;
	color:#898989;
}
#course dl dd a{
	font-weight:normal;
	color:#4f4f4f;
}

.hh2{text-align:center; color:#5d5d5d; font-size:30px; margin:27px 0; font:30px '微软雅黑';}


.banx .banx_con{ background:url(http://uid.tedu.cn/lanmu/mfst/images/kc_bg.jpg) no-repeat; width:450px; height:180px; }
.banx .banx_con b{ text-align:center; display:block; text-align:center; color:#ffcd00; font-size:20px; line-height:50px;}
.banx .banx_con b span{ color:#ffff00;}
.banx .banx_con p{ color:#cdcdcd; font-size:16px; text-align:left;padding:7px 10px; line-height:30px;}
.banx .banx_con p a{ float:right; display:block; font-size:14px; font-weight:bold; color:#bd0000; padding:0px 8px; line-height:24px; background:#ffffff; margin-right:15px;}



.video,.video1{ background:url(http://www.tarena.com.cn/zt/2014mfst/images/hui_bg.jpg) no-repeat; width:489px; height:261px;}
.teach_nr{ font-family:"微软雅黑";color:#cacaca; margin-top:50px; margin-left:15px; width:213px; }
.message{
	overflow: hidden;
	padding:20px;
	width:960px;
	margin:auto;
	padding-top:80px;
	background-color: #F2F2F2;
	padding-bottom: 30px;
	position: relative;
}
.message-title{
	text-align: center;
	position: absolute;
	top:16px;
	left:327px;
}
.message h1{
	display: inline-block;
	width:348px;
	height:60px;
	border-radius: 4px;
	color: #333;
	font-size: 30px;
	font-weight: normal;
	line-height:60px;
	letter-spacing:3px;
	position: relative;
	top:5px;
}
.message-cont{
	overflow: hidden;
	margin-top:15px;
}
.message-cont .mess{
	width:45%;
	float: left;
	font-size: 16px;
}
.message-cont .mess.fir{
	margin-right:30px;
	padding-right: 40px;
	border-right: 1px dashed #aaa;
}
.message-cont .mess li{
	padding-left: 50px;
	font-size: 16px;
}
.message-cont .mess li a{
	display:block;
	color:#333;
	text-decoration:none;
}
.message-cont .mess li a:hover{
	color:#f00;
}
.message-cont .mess span{
	display: inline-block;
	width:40px;
	height:40px;
	background:url("../images/num.png");
	position: relative;
	text-align: center;
	line-height:40px;
	color:#fff;
	margin-right:20px;
}
.message-cont .mess li a:hover span{
	background:url("../images/nums.png");
}